U.N. Envoy Tries to Ease Tensions in Myanmar
By SETH MYDANS

BANGKOK, Sept. 30 — A United Nations envoy to Myanmar met Sunday with the detained opposition leader Daw Aung San Suu Kyi and with several members of the military junta that last week crushed a peaceful pro-democracy uprising, the United Nations said.

The envoy, Ibrahim Gambari, spent more than an hour at a government guesthouse in the main city, Yangon, with Mrs. Aung San Suu Kyi, who has been under house arrest for 12 of the past 18 years. He spent Saturday and Sunday nights in the administrative capital, Naypyidaw, 200 miles north of Yangon, where he met with government officials but not the top two leaders.
